</h2> <h3>Early Season Stakes and Context</h3> Thursday evening's clash between <strong>Hertha BSC and SV Elversberg</strong> at Berlin's Olympiastadion carries significant early-season weight, with both clubs seeking to establish their 2025-26 trajectories after contrasting starts to the campaign. Hertha, languishing in 17th position with just two points from three matches, desperately need to convert home advantage into their first victory, while seventh-placed Elversberg aim to maintain momentum despite concerning away form. <h3>Tactical Setup and Key Personnel</h3> <strong>Cristian Fiél</strong> is expected to persist with Hertha's defensively-minded 3-4-2-1 system that has provided solidity but stifled creativity. <strong>Tjark Ernst</strong> continues in goal behind a back three likely featuring <strong>Linus Gechter, Toni Leistner, and Márton Dárdai</strong>. The creative burden falls heavily on <strong>Mickaël Cuisance</strong> and <strong>Maurice Krattenmacher</strong>, with <strong>Sebastian Grönning</strong> - the club's only goalscorer this season - expected to lead the line despite limited minutes. Elversberg's <strong>Horst Steffen</strong> faces team selection complexities with <strong>Jan Gyamerah's</strong> suspension concerns following his red card. <strong>Nicolas Kristof</strong> anchors a defense that has shown home resilience but away vulnerability. <strong>Bambasé Conté</strong> provides the creative spark in midfield, supporting a front line where <strong>Luca Schnellbacher</strong> seeks to continue his goalscoring form. <h3>Form Analysis and Statistical Patterns</h3> The underlying statistics paint a fascinating narrative of contrasting approaches. Hertha's defensive organization has yielded a remarkable 67% clean sheet rate, significantly above the league average of 26%, yet their offensive output remains catastrophically low at 0.33 goals per game versus the 1.31 league standard. Their failure to score in 67% of matches - more than double the league average - represents the season's most concerning statistical trend. Elversberg's numbers reveal a tale of two venues: perfect home form with six points from six and a +2 goal difference, contrasted by complete away capitulation with zero points and a -2 goal difference. This dramatic home-away split suggests tactical rigidity that struggles to adapt to different environments. <h3>Historical Context and Psychological Factors</h3> The recent head-to-head record heavily favors Elversberg, with three victories in the last four meetings creating a psychological advantage that transcends current form. Their 2-1 victory at this venue last season, sealed by a 90th-minute winner, will resonate strongly with both sets of players. For Hertha, breaking this recent dominance becomes crucial for season-long confidence. <h3>Individual Battles and X-Factors</h3> <strong>Sebastian Grönning's</strong> late equalizer against Schalke represents Hertha's sole moment of attacking joy, making his fitness and tactical deployment crucial. His direct running style could exploit spaces behind Elversberg's high defensive line, particularly if <strong>Gyamerah's</strong> absence disrupts their defensive coordination. <strong>Maximilian Rohr's</strong> leadership at the heart of Elversberg's defense will be tested by Hertha's direct approach, while <strong>Tom Zimmerschied's</strong> creative influence from midfield could prove decisive in unlocking a stubbornly organized home defense. <h3>Weather and Environmental Factors</h3> Perfect late-summer conditions in Berlin eliminate weather variables, placing full focus on tactical execution. The Olympiastadion's vast dimensions may favor Elversberg's counter-attacking style, though Hertha's desperate need for points should generate intense home support. <h3>Prediction and Key Insights</h3> The statistical evidence overwhelmingly points toward a low-scoring encounter. Hertha's defensive solidity at home, combined with their offensive struggles and Elversberg's away scoring difficulties, creates strong Under 2.5 goals potential. The historical head-to-head dynamic suggests Elversberg possess the tactical blueprint to frustrate Hertha, potentially claiming a narrow victory that continues their recent dominance in this fixture. <strong>Expect a cagey, tactical battle where defensive organization trumps attacking ambition, with late goals likely decisive in determining the outcome.</strong>
